T

This company is amazing! Their products are top qu...

This company is amazing! Their products are top quality and their customer service is outstanding. I had a minor issue with one of my orders and they resolved it quickly and efficiently. I am extremely satisfied with my experience and will definitely be a repeat customer.

Comments:

No comments